Output 267991832aa4c56042d2851e2aa13cd77c70e31c0db6566dd72c81a893e0ff60:1

value
374537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6151841f27a5484452b063b39c5b4b0a933b77d6 OP_EQUAL
address
3AZb7zL6oGhqsqHUayWNH5nqvARCQQfdfx
transaction
267991832aa4c56042d2851e2aa13cd77c70e31c0db6566dd72c81a893e0ff60
spent
true